Georgia-Pacific Containerboard in Toledo, OR facility is a containerboard mill that was built in 1957 as the company's first pulp and paper mill.
The facility has approximately 400 employees and manufactures both linerboard and corrugated medium on three paper machines, using both virgin and recycled fiber.

Your Job
Flint Hills Resources is hiring for an Instrumentation Technician to join the maintenance group at our refinery in Corpus Christi, Texas!
Our Team
Our Instrumentation shop maintains over around 50,000 controllers, solenoids, switches, transmitters, valves and wireless devices in our refinery in Corpus Christi.
We are a team of hardworking tradespeople that thrive on keeping our equipment running and calibrated.
Our team consists of top talent in the oil and gas industry as well as up and coming technicians.
Whatever your skill level, we are committed to your future with FHR!
What You Will Do
* Daily troubleshooting & repair of instrumentation in live process units.
* Instrument turnaround maintenance activities (ID potential scope items, enter T/A work orders, lead work crews for scope as assigned, and perform instrument scope work)
* Work a 4/10 day-shift schedule (M-Th) and participate in an afterhours/on-call rotation
Who You Are (Basic Qualifications)
* Work experience in the Instrumentation craft in any industry OR a graduate of an Instrumentation Degree Program
* Possess a valid US Driver's License
What Will Put You Ahead
* 3 years' experience in the Instrumentation trade
* Mechanical experience in an industrial environment
